French Door Varieties
French doors come in a range of styles, products, and setups, each serving different visual and practical functions. The following table summarizes common types of French doors:
| Type | Description |
|---|---|
| Conventional | Traditional design with several little panes of glass framed by wood. |
| Modern | Streamlined styles frequently making use of larger panes of glass with very little framing. |
| Sliding French Doors | Doors that slide open instead of swing, suitable for tight spaces. |
| Double French Doors | Two doors that open from the center, producing an excellent entry point. |
| French Patio Doors | Developed specifically for patios, often featuring broader frames for bigger openings. |
The Benefits of French Doors
- Natural Light: The large glass panels enable abundant natural light, cheering up rooms and minimizing reliance on artificial lighting.
- Visual Appeal: French doors are known for their classy and timeless look, improving the overall appearance of a home.
- Indoor-Outdoor Connection: They create a fluid transition in between indoor and outside spaces, making them perfect for entertaining or enjoying views of gardens.
- Adaptability: French doors can be used in numerous settings, from living spaces and dining areas to patio areas and conservatories.
- Increased Property Value: High-quality, well-installed French doors can contribute to the total worth of a home, making it more attractive to potential purchasers.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. Just how much do French doors cost?
The expense of French doors can differ commonly based upon materials, design, and installation complexity. On average, homeowners can expect to pay anywhere from ₤ 1,200 to ₤ 5,000, including installation.
2. What materials are best for French doors?
Common materials consist of wood, fiberglass, and vinyl. Wood uses a classic look however needs maintenance, while fiberglass and vinyl are long lasting and low-maintenance alternatives.
3. The length of time does it take to set up French doors?
Installation can normally take anywhere from a couple of hours to a full day, depending upon the complexity of the task and the carpenter's workload.
4. Can French doors be used in place of regular doors?
Yes, French doors can replace basic doors for a more elegant and roomy option. Nevertheless, appropriate measurements are important for an effective swap.
5. Do French doors supply excellent insulation?
Modern French doors can use outstanding insulation, specifically those equipped with energy-efficient glass. House owners must think about double-glazed options for much better thermal efficiency.
